Book and author: Zemlja Snova by Tomislav Tomic.
All of the colors that I used more or less for my mossy rock are:
-Cream - 102
-Light Yellow Glaze - 104
-Dark Cadmium Yellow -108
-Green Gold - 268
-Brown Ochre - 182
-Raw Umber -180
-Bistre -179
-Van-Dyck-Brown - 176
-Walnut Brown - 177 (it's really similar to the Van-Dyck one)
-Olive Green Yellowish - 173
-May Green - 170
-Grass Green - 166
-Chromium Green Opaque - 174 ( I just used this one interchangeably with the 173 one)
-Dark Sepia - 175
White Posca pen and white uni-ball Signo pen
At the end I accentuated, off-camera, a bit more the pale greens with a darker green (but you can choose how much definition you want).
